The Department of Medical Student Education has an exciting opportunity for a Part-time Teacher Assistant (Proctor) to work in Miami, Fl. The Teacher Assistant provides grading support for undergraduate classes; development of rubrics for formative and summative assessments; examination and measured assessment of student work; provide quantitative and qualitative feedback to students; data entry and statistical analysis of results.

  • Helps Teachers with lesson preparation, including collecting materials and setting up equipment.

  • Reviews lessons or lectures with students on a one-on-one basis or in small groups.

  • Supervises students in class, between classes, and during examinations.

  • Assists with tracking attendance, grading assignments, and calculating grades.

  • Gives extra help to students who need special accommodations or are struggling with a concept.

  • Assists students with special learning requirements, including disabilities or English as a second language students.

  • Attends faculty meetings and parent conferences as needed.

  • Collaborates with the Teacher to identify students' issues and recommend solutions.

  • Observes the state, school and class rules, and regulations.

  • Adheres to University and unit-level policies and safeguards University assets.

DEPARTMENT SPECIFIC FUNCTIONS

  • Serve as proctor enforcing all requirements and conditions associated with exams for medical students .

  • Monitors test rooms during the administration of examinations .

  • Enforces time limits and compliance with other examination procedures.

  • Explains and answers questions concerning examination procedures and related matters.

  • Distributes examination materials to candidates as needed.
